pinger versus transponder

I would be extremely skeptical of the Chinese operatng their hand held Teledyne detector receiver. The avionics acoustic pinger that is currently used has not changed much in the last 50 years and although it can supposedly operate for 30 days, I doubt whether it can be detected outside a 500m range. Diver's bells also use this safety equipment in the form a transponder on the same 37.5Khz freq which will give a range and bearing which a pinger will not do, when interrogated but with more range but I have never seen one operate in ideal conditions beyond 600m.
